I tried your tkln/hs200 branch on Colibri T20, Apalis/Colibri T30 and
Apalis TK1. It at least does not seem to make things any worse but
HS200 on TK1 still seems to behave strangely. During boot I do get the
following message (mmc0 being the SDHCI instance of one of them SD card
slots):

[ 3.238360] mmc0: Internal clock never stabilised.

After that it actually seems to work quite nicely:

root@apalis-tk1-mainline:~# cat /sys/kernel/debug/mmc2/ios
clock: 200000000 Hz
actual clock: 163200000 Hz
vdd: 21 (3.3 ~ 3.4 V)
bus mode: 2 (push-pull)
chip select: 0 (don't care)
power mode: 2 (on)
bus width: 3 (8 bits)
timing spec: 9 (mmc HS200)
signal voltage: 1 (1.80 V)
driver type: 0 (driver type B)
root@apalis-tk1-mainline:~# hdparm -t /dev/mmcblk2

/dev/mmcblk2:
Timing buffered disk reads: 408 MB in 3.01 seconds = 135.39 MB/sec

Have you ever observed similar behaviour? What could cause this?

Anybody else tried it on TK1?
